How they compare
Luxembourg currently reports 59 against 45.53 in Spain, a difference of 13.47.
That makes Luxembourg's figure about 1.3 times Spain's.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 17 shared years of data; in 2004 it was Luxembourg ahead.
Luxembourg ranks 8th and Spain ranks 10th of 185 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Luxembourg averaged higher in 2 and Spain in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Luxembourg | Spain |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 100 | 101.01 | 1.01 | Spain |
| 2010s | 77.7 | 70.41 | 7.29 | Luxembourg |
| 2020s | 59 | 45.53 | 13.47 | Luxembourg |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
